National Hospital Week is just around the corner! From May 12 through May 18, health professionals everywhere will be celebrating the nation’s largest healthcare event. National Hospital Week is a celebration of history, technology, and the dedicated professionals that make healthcare facilities across America renowned for being excellent places to receive care and treatment. National Hospital Week is also a time to recognize hardworking hospital staff, and to promote the mission of health and well-being.

With celebrations beginning in 1921, National Hospital Week began when a magazine editor in Chicago suggested that more information about hospitals might help to alleviate public fears about the healthcare system. Since then, the celebration has succeeded in promoting both trust and goodwill among members of the public.

Hospitals across the country are encouraged to plan activities throughout the week to recognize and celebrate the quality care that their staffs provide.

All professionals in the healthcare industry are welcome to celebrate National Hospital Week – from Medical Assistants to Massage Therapists, Pharmacy Technicians to Phlebotomists.
